A question asked a lot is ‘Can a Ragdoll Cat be Grey?

When you look at a ragdoll cat breeder’s website, you might be surprised to see no mention of grey ragdoll cats. This is because grey ragdoll cats are identified by the technical term ‘blue’ and not ‘grey’.

The Ragdoll cat is a large, longhaired cat with a docile temperament. They come in a variety of colors and patterns, but the traditional colors are Seal, Blue, Chocolate, Lilac, Flame and Cream.  Although it is called blue, a blue point Ragdoll is actually a warm grey/taupe color that varies in intensity from cat to cat.

The Blue Point Ragdoll has a grey coat with darker points on the ears, muzzle, tail, and feet. Geographic location and diet, as well as the cat’s genetics, determine the colour of its body which can be anywhere from light to dark grey. A Ragdoll’s core body temperature can influence its colour. As a Ragdoll cat ages, its internal body temperature decreases, causing the fur to become lighter in colour, from dark grey as a young cat to light grey when it reaches its senior years.

Blue Ragdoll Cat Patterns

Three Blue Ragdoll Cat pattern variations exist – bicolor, colourpoint, and mitted, each with grey colours. There are also subvariations of tortie and lynx. Let’s look at the Ragdoll Cat patterns in more detail:

Blue Color Point Ragdoll

Blue Colour Point Ragdolls have dark grey paws, tails, ears, noses, and faces, in addition to dark grey nose leather and paw pads. Their bodycolour will range from light to dark grey in tone, with grey-ish white being common. As with all officially recognised purebred Ragdolls, their eyes will be blue.

Blue Mitted Ragdoll

Blue Mitted Ragdolls look the same as the blue color point Ragdolls with their grey coat and blue eyes, except that they have white mittens on their paws and white belly stripes that extend from their chin to their genitals.

Blue Bicolor Ragdoll

A grey Ragdoll with an inverted V mask on its face and white paws with pink paw pads is known as the Bicolor Blue Ragdoll Cat.

Blue Lynx Ragdoll

The striking-looking Blue lynx ragdoll has a grey face with tabby markings and white eyeliner. A blue lynx mitted has a distinctive appearance with a white moustache, white eyeliner, and pink nose.

Blue Tortie Ragdoll

Only female Ragdolls can be of the Tortie pattern. A Blue Tortie Ragdoll will have grey and cream tortoiseshell markings.
